Seven has prolonged an episode of 7News Highlight to display screen on Sunday, doubling its size with a narrative on Ben Besan, the previous NSW Police Tactical Operations Unit Officer who took down terrorist Man Monis on the Lindt Cafe in 2014.

For the previous decade he has solely been often called’ ‘Officer A.’  Yesterday the NSW Coroner’s Court docket, lifted a suppression order which had prevented him from ever publicly telling his story.

This Sunday, Besant will for the very first time share his expertise of the second he got here face-to-face with evil and the emotional devastation he endured within the wake of the tragedy.

Chatting with 7NEWS Chief Reporter Chris Cause, Besant defined how the suppression order has fuelled the PTSD which value him his profession, marriage and residential: “I’m by no means one to stroll away from a battle, and I’ve been preventing for a very long time to have my title returned to me and all of the issues I can deliver and provide to individuals who undergo from the identical situation.

“That’s what I’ve been preventing so exhausting for – to be allowed to share my title and my story and put my title to my story. It’s turn into such an enormous difficulty for me to have the ability to get my title again, and with out you and Channel 7 that wouldn’t have occurred.”

Cause, who watched your complete siege unfold from Seven’s former Martin Place headquarters, stated of the court docket ruling: “This can be a beautiful victory for Ben Besant. He has fought for years to have his identification launched, and eventually the courts have backed him.

7NEWS is proud to have helped him lastly get his identification again. It means the world to him and offers him the facility to do what he has longed to do – assist others who’re grappling with huge trauma of PTSD.”
